When to Choose Shimano reels
Here is what I use mine for: Curado 70 HG - Jerkbaits Tranx XG - Jigs Curado 200K HG - Lipless/Squarebills Metanium 13 - Spinnerbaits Bantam MGL XG - Topwater Curado 70 MGL XG - 3/16 Texas Rig Casitas 150 HG - Med/Deep Cranks Bantam MGL - Chatterbaits Metanium 20 XG - 1/4 Texas Rig Curado 200K XG - 5/16 Texas Rig SLX MGL 70 XG - Ned Rig Bantam MGL XG - 3/8 Texas Rig Bantam MGL XG - Frogs Scorpion MGL XG - 1/2 Texas Rig Bantam MGL HG - Heavy Jig/Texas Rig Cardiff 200 - Swimbait/A-Rig
